Kodama Corporation staffs a helpline to answer questions from customers. The costs of operating the helpline are variable with respect to the number of calls in a month. At a volume of 30,000 calls in a month, the costs of operating the helpline total $369,000. To the nearest whole cent, what should be the average cost of operating the helpline per call at a volume of 31,300 calls in a month? (Assume that this call volume is within the relevant range.)

Definitions:

Change in Supply

An alteration in the quantity of a product that producers are willing and able to sell in the market, due to factors like changes in cost of production or technological improvements.

Quantity Supplied

The quantity supplied refers to the amount of a good or service that producers are willing to sell at a given price over a specified period.

Rationing Function

The process by which a scarce resource is distributed among competing users.

Dynamic Pricing

A pricing strategy where prices are adjusted in real-time based on demand, supply, and other market conditions.
